Output 619b6dc65db4abc3d4be1b80a9988feee48141f55d3fd24607b6c506195948df:1

value
16636076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13660d815664b93efe5d2346be17440abbda4015 OP_EQUAL
address
33Tb1wNWBp549SxYr3K87Ptcyz4UoFzHqw
transaction
619b6dc65db4abc3d4be1b80a9988feee48141f55d3fd24607b6c506195948df
confirmations
320534
spent
true